数据库学了以后学什么

fiy 其他 2

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    学完数据库后,你可以继续学习以下内容:

    1. 数据结构与算法:数据库是数据存储和管理的基础,而数据结构与算法则是对数据进行操作和处理的基础。学习数据结构与算法可以帮助你更好地理解和设计数据库系统,提高数据处理的效率和准确性。

    2. 数据分析与数据挖掘:数据库中存储了大量的数据,而数据分析和数据挖掘则是从这些数据中提取有价值的信息和模式。学习数据分析和数据挖掘技术可以帮助你发现隐藏在数据中的规律和趋势,从而支持决策和业务发展。

    3. 数据库管理与优化:数据库管理是指对数据库进行配置、监控和维护的过程,包括备份恢复、安全管理、性能优化等。学习数据库管理与优化可以帮助你提高数据库的稳定性和性能,并解决日常运维中的各种问题。

    4. 数据库编程与开发:数据库编程是指使用编程语言与数据库进行交互和操作的过程,包括SQL语言的使用、存储过程和触发器的编写等。学习数据库编程可以帮助你更灵活地操作数据库,并实现一些复杂的业务逻辑和功能。

    5. 大数据与云计算:随着数据规模的不断增大和技术的不断进步,大数据和云计算成为了数据库领域的热门方向。学习大数据和云计算可以让你了解和应用分布式数据库、NoSQL数据库、云数据库等新兴技术,从而适应行业的发展需求。

    综上所述,数据库是计算机领域中非常重要的一个基础知识,学完数据库后可以继续深入学习与之相关的内容,提升自己的技能水平,并为未来的职业发展打下坚实的基础。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    学完数据库之后,可以继续学习以下内容:

    1. 数据结构与算法:数据库是建立在数据结构和算法基础上的,学习数据结构和算法可以帮助我们更好地理解数据库的底层原理和优化技巧,提高数据库的性能和效率。

    2. 操作系统:数据库是在操作系统上运行的,学习操作系统可以帮助我们更好地理解数据库的运行原理和管理技术,提高数据库的安全性和稳定性。

    3. 编程语言:数据库的开发和管理通常需要编程技能,学习一门或多门编程语言(如SQL、Python、Java等)可以帮助我们更好地编写数据库程序和脚本,实现数据库的自动化管理和数据分析。

    4. 网络技术:数据库通常是通过网络进行访问和操作的,学习网络技术可以帮助我们更好地理解数据库的网络架构和通信协议,提高数据库的网络性能和安全性。

    5. 数据挖掘和大数据技术:随着数据量的不断增加,数据挖掘和大数据技术变得越来越重要。学习数据挖掘和大数据技术可以帮助我们更好地分析和利用数据库中的大量数据,挖掘其中的价值和潜力。

    6. 数据库管理系统(DBMS)的高级特性:学习数据库管理系统的高级特性,如事务处理、并发控制、备份与恢复、性能优化等,可以帮助我们更好地管理和维护数据库,提高数据库的可靠性和可用性。

    7. 数据库安全和隐私保护:随着数据泄露和隐私侵犯事件的不断发生,数据库安全和隐私保护变得越来越重要。学习数据库安全和隐私保护的技术和方法,可以帮助我们更好地保护数据库中的数据,防止数据被恶意使用或泄露。

    8. 数据库云计算和虚拟化技术:随着云计算和虚拟化技术的快速发展,数据库的部署和管理方式也在发生变化。学习数据库云计算和虚拟化技术可以帮助我们更好地理解和应用这些新技术,提高数据库的灵活性和可扩展性。

    总之,学完数据库之后,可以继续深入学习与数据库相关的技术和领域,不断提升自己的专业能力和竞争力。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    学完数据库以后,可以继续学习以下内容:

    1. 数据库管理系统(Database Management System,简称DBMS)的高级特性:数据库管理系统是用于管理和操作数据库的软件系统,数据库管理系统的高级特性包括事务处理、并发控制、故障恢复、数据安全等方面的知识。深入学习数据库管理系统的高级特性,可以帮助你更好地设计和管理数据库系统。

    2. 数据库设计与规范化:数据库设计是指根据应用需求,将数据组织成适合存储和检索的结构的过程。规范化是一种数据组织和设计的方法,通过分解数据表并建立关系,消除冗余和数据不一致性,提高数据库的性能和可维护性。

    3. 数据库查询语言:数据库查询语言(Database Query Language,简称SQL)是用于与数据库进行交互的语言。学习SQL可以帮助你编写复杂的数据库查询语句,实现数据的检索、更新、删除等操作。

    4. 数据库编程:数据库编程是指使用编程语言与数据库进行交互的过程。你可以学习如何使用编程语言(如Java、Python等)连接数据库,执行SQL语句,实现数据库的增删改查操作。

    5. 数据库安全与性能优化:学习数据库安全和性能优化的知识可以帮助你保护数据库的安全性,提高数据库的性能。你可以学习如何设置用户权限、进行数据加密、实现备份与恢复等操作,以及如何通过索引、查询优化等技术提高数据库的性能。

    6. 数据仓库与数据挖掘:数据仓库是指将多个数据库中的数据集成到一个统一的数据存储中,用于支持决策分析和数据挖掘。学习数据仓库和数据挖掘的知识可以帮助你利用大量数据进行分析和挖掘,发现其中的规律和趋势,从而支持决策和业务发展。

    7. NoSQL数据库:除了关系型数据库外,还有一类非关系型数据库(NoSQL),其使用不同的数据模型来存储和检索数据。学习NoSQL数据库可以帮助你了解不同类型的数据库,并根据需求选择合适的数据库技术。

    总之,学完数据库后,你可以继续学习数据库管理系统的高级特性、数据库设计与规范化、数据库查询语言、数据库编程、数据库安全与性能优化、数据仓库与数据挖掘、NoSQL数据库等内容,从而更加深入地了解和应用数据库技术。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部